As a newbie myself how do you find the ETX 80?

Thanks for the replies everyone!

Hi Alex,

The controls on the ETX-80 are really straight forward, and it comes with a compass + bubble level eyepiece to make setting up really easy. The optics are good enough for me (having no basis for comparison), the moon was bright and clear with plenty of sharp detail. The tripod seems sturdy enough (I'm into photography, so I have a few... it is pretty solid). I've not been able to use the autostar system "in the field" yet for two reasons, a lot of patchy cloud cover last night meant most of the "initialisation stars" were obstructed and secondly and most importantly the time was not set properly so it was looking to the sky 7 minutes behind where it should have been :smiley:
